Programming Basics SQL HTML CSS JavaScript Python C++ Java JavaFX Swing Problem Solving English English Conversations Computer Fundamentals Learn Typing

جميع المقالات

طريقة تحويل الفيديو إلى صورة متحركة GIF بواسطة لغة بايثون

في هذا المقال ستتعلم طريقة تحويل الفيديوهات إلى صور متحركة GIF بكل سهولة بواسطة لغة بايثون و بالإعتماد على الموديول moviepy خطوة خطوة.

طريقة جعل العنصر يدور عند تمرير الماوس فوقه بواسطة CSS

في هذا المقال ستتعلم كيف تجعل العنصر يدور في مكانه عند تمرير مؤشر الماوس (Mouse Cursor) فوقه بخطوات بسيطة جداً. بشكل عام لجعل العنصر قابل للدوران يجب أن يكون له حجم بحيث نستطيع تمرير الماوس فوقه و يجب تحديد خلال كم جزء من الثانية نريد أن يدور العنصر خلال نفسه و هذا الأمر نفعله بإضافة الخاصية transition للعنصر. الآن لجعله يدور عند تمرير مؤشر الماوس فوقه دورة كاملة حول نفسه (أي 360 درجة) فإننا نحتاج فقط إضافة الخاصية transform: rotate(360deg) له.

الطريقة الصحيحة لقراءة التوثيقات البرمجية

كثير من المبتدئين في البرمجة يواجهون صعوبة في فهم و قراءة الوثائق (Documentations) البرمجية عند البحث عن مشكلة معينة ومحاولة الوصول لحلها. في هذا المقال وضعنا نصائح ذهبية تساعدك على فهم الوثائق بشكل أفضل.

الفرق بين لغة HTML و لغة XML

في البداية، أحرف HTML هي اختصار لعبارة Hyper Text Markup Language و التي تعني لغة ترميز النص التشعّبي. أحرف XML هي اختصار لعبارة eXtensible Markup Language و التي تعني لغة الترميز القابلة للتمدّد.

طرق طباعة المخرجات في الكونسول في جافاسكربت

في هذا المقال ستتعرف على الدوال الموجودة في الكلاس console و التي يمكن استخدامها لطباعة المحتوى في كونسول المتصفح بأشكال مختلفة خطوة خطوة.

تطوير برامج بايثون باستخدام Eclipse

في هذا المقال ستتعلم كيفية إنشاء مشروع بلغة بايثون باستخدام برنامج Eclipse و من خلال الإضافة PyDev خطوة خطوة.

نصائح للدراسة

في هذا المقال سنستعرض بعض النصائح الدراسية و التطبيقات التي من الممكن أن تساعد الطلاب خلال مسيرتهم الدراسية.

حل المشاكل البرمجية

المشاكل البرمجية (Problems Solving) هي تحديات و تمارين برمجية الهدف منها تطوير قدراتك في التحليل و حل المشاكل البرمجية. لذلك حين تتمرن على حل هذه التحديات فأنت بذلك تكون تطور قدراتك في البرمجة بحد ذاتها. تحديات المشاكل البرمجية تكون بمستويات مختلفة، هناك تمارين تكون متشابهة و هناك تمارين تكون مختلفة و تجعلك مجبر على التفكير بطرق إبداعية لإجاد حلول لها.

طريقة تركيب الكتابة على صورة باستخدام CSS

وضع نص عشوائي في وسم <p> وضع الصورة التي نريد دمجها مع نص الوسم <p> كخلفية له بواسطة خصائص CSS. وضع بلوك غير مرئي أمام الوسم <p> بواسطة خصائص CSS حتى نجعل النص الموجود على الصورة لا يمكن لمسه و بالتالي تصبح الصورة و الكتابة كأنها فعلاً صورة واحد.

الفرق بين Web 1.0 و Web 2.0 و Web 3.0

كثر الكلام مؤخراً عن تقنيات Web3.0 و التي اشتهرت بشكل كبير في مواقع تواصل إجتماعي و الإعلام و غيرها. في هذا المقال ستتعرف على تقنيات الويب الثلاثة Web1.0 و Web2.0 و Web3.0.

الدورات

أدوات مساعدة

أقسام الموقع

دورات
مقالات كتب مشاريع أسئلة